that could be a bit difficult depending on their situation.
if his roommate is not on the lease then he can have him removed and ask the landlord to change the locks.

if his roommate is on the lease then he has to give 30 days notice to his roommate or get a court order of eviction.
he simply can't kick him out.

now he can remove himself from the lease if he can get an agreement with the apartment owner and his roommate to take over the apartment.
there are a lot of sticky legal issues here. one reason I never had a roommate.
